Skip to content

Define version pattern in a single place#153

Merged
ycombinator merged 4 commits intoelastic:masterfrom
ycombinator:changelog-manifest-version-match
Mar 23, 2021
Merged

Define version pattern in a single place#153
ycombinator merged 4 commits intoelastic:masterfrom
ycombinator:changelog-manifest-version-match

Conversation

@ycombinator
Copy link
Copy Markdown
Contributor

@ycombinator ycombinator commented Mar 23, 2021

What does this PR do?

This PR defines the pattern for a version in a single place and references it from multiple version properties.

Why is it important?

So the pattern for a version doesn't need to be duplicated in multiple places, introducing a potential for drift and inconsistencies.

Checklist

  • I have added test packages to test/packages that prove my change is effective. Existing packages have versions in them already.
  • I have added an entry in versions/N/changelog.yml. No changelog entry as this is a refactoring, not a user-facing change.

@elasticmachine
Copy link
Copy Markdown

elasticmachine commented Mar 23, 2021

💚 Build Succeeded

the below badges are clickable and redirect to their specific view in the CI or DOCS
Pipeline View Test View Changes Artifacts preview

Expand to view the summary

Build stats

  • Build Cause: Pull request #153 updated

  • Start Time: 2021-03-23T14:11:15.264+0000

  • Duration: 7 min 14 sec

  • Commit: 3ed26f4

Trends 🧪

Image of Build Times

@ycombinator ycombinator marked this pull request as ready for review March 23, 2021 14:04
@ycombinator ycombinator requested a review from mtojek March 23, 2021 14:04
Copy link
Copy Markdown
Contributor

@mtojek mtojek left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@ycombinator ycombinator merged commit 9ce2ae1 into elastic:master Mar 23, 2021
@ycombinator ycombinator deleted the changelog-manifest-version-match branch March 23, 2021 14:19
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ants